I love the so-called "Frankenstein fleet" ships from DS9. The ultimate "ugly cute" ships.
The bizarre "Elkins-class" Intrepid/Miranda-class kitbash model from #StarTrek DS9, built by and named for VFX supervisor Judy Elkins.

Components include saucer (Voyager), pylons (runabout), nacelles (Reliant), body (F-14 fighter jet)
